Sealcoating Solutions for Longevity

Sealcoating solutions serve a vital function in extending the lifespan of asphalt surfaces by offering a protective barrier against environmental damage. Regular application of sealant can substantially increase longevity and aesthetics, making it an essential aspect of upkeep. Implementing a recommended maintenance schedule ensures that the positive effects of sealcoating are maximized over time.

Sealcoating Benefits

Preserving asphalt surfaces is vital for their longevity, and one highly effective method is sealcoating. This process consists of applying a protective layer that shields the asphalt from harmful elements such as UV rays, water, and oil. By blocking oxidation and moisture penetration, sealcoating substantially reduces the risk of cracks and potholes, prolonging the life of the pavement. Moreover, sealcoating boosts the appearance of asphalt, giving it a fresh, dark finish that improves curb appeal for both residential and commercial properties. Moreover, it helps with resisting the wear and tear caused by heavy traffic and extreme weather conditions. Overall, sealcoating serves as a budget-friendly strategy for preserving asphalt integrity, ultimately helping property owners money on repairs and replacements.

Advised Maintenance Schedule

A well-planned maintenance schedule is critical for maximizing the benefits of sealcoating and maintaining the longevity of asphalt surfaces. Typically, it is recommended that both commercial and residential properties undergo sealcoating every two to three years, depending on traffic levels and environmental conditions. Regular inspections are crucial, as they can help locate cracks or damage early, allowing for timely repairs. Additionally, property owners should establish a routine of cleaning the surface to remove oil, debris, and chemicals that can degrade the asphalt. Developing a proactive maintenance plan not only prolongs the life of the surface but also boosts its appearance and safety. By adhering to this schedule, property owners can safeguard their investments effectively.

Crack Filling and Repair for Asphalt

Untreated cracks in asphalt can develop into serious damage, making timely treatment and maintenance crucial. Asphalt crack treatment and fixing require identifying and treating fissures to inhibit water penetration and additional damage. Professionals utilize specialized materials, such as hot rubberized sealants, which expand and contract with temperature changes, ensuring durability. The process commences with clearing the cracks to clear rubble and dampness, followed by applying the sealant to thoroughly close the spaces. This service not only enhances the durability of the asphalt but also enhances the overall appearance of the surface. Regular maintenance, including crack filling, is vital for home and business locations, safeguarding investments and ensuring safe access for motorists and pedestrians together.

Materials Utilized

Picking the appropriate materials for line striping and marking is a fundamental aspect that directly influences the longevity and visibility of the markings. Asphalt contractors typically employ a selection of paint types, including water-based, solvent-based, and thermoplastic materials. Water-based paints are chosen for their fast drying time and eco-friendliness, making them perfect for residential applications. Solvent-based paints provide improved durability and resistance to weather conditions, ideal for high-traffic commercial areas. Thermoplastic materials, which are heated and applied, deliver exceptional lifespan and visibility, often used for long-lasting markings. Additionally, reflective materials can be incorporated to boost visibility at night or in low-light conditions, providing safety for drivers and pedestrians alike. Each material choice supports the specific needs of the property.

Common Questions

How Long Is the Curing Period for Asphalt After Installation?

Asphalt generally needs 24 to 48 hours to set after installation. However, full curing can take several weeks, based on environmental conditions such as temperature, humidity, and the thickness of the asphalt layer installed.

What Elements Impact the Price of Asphalt Services?

Various factors influence the cost of asphalt services, including material quality, scope of work, location, labor rates, and added components like drainage or reinforcement. Every element plays a vital role in establishing overall pricing.

Is Asphalt Application Feasible in Cold Weather?

Asphalt may be installed in cold weather, but it necessitates special techniques and materials to guarantee proper adhesion and curing. Cold temperatures can compromise the performance, resulting in potential long-term complications if not managed correctly.

How Frequently Should I Seal My Asphalt Surface?

It's advisable to seal an asphalt surface every three to five years, depending on factors such as climate, usage, and wear. Regular sealing helps maintain durability and appearance, lengthening the lifespan of the asphalt.

What Is the Expected Lifespan of an Asphalt Driveway?

An asphalt driveway generally lasts between 15 to 30 years, contingent upon factors such as climate, maintenance, and usage. Routine sealing and repairs can significantly extend its lifespan, ensuring long-lasting performance and visual appeal over time.
